- The distance between Oran, Algeria and Bambesa, Democratic Republic Of The Congo is approximately 4,485 km or 2,787 mi.
- To reach Oran in this distance one would set out from Bambesa bearing 326.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Oran bearing 316.9° or NW .
- Oran has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Bambesa has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Oran is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as Bambesa is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 6.6 °C (11.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.4 °C (22.3°F) more in Oran.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1356.8 mm (53.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1356.8 l/m² (33.3 US gal/ft²) or 13,568,000 l/ha (1,450,509 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- There are 732 more hours of sunlight per year in Oran. In whichever way circa 1h 59' more per day or about 1 1/3 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.2° lower in Oran than in Bambesa.
- Relative humidity levels are 10.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4°C (7.2°F) lower.
